    Hey Chris, I'm not sure who is curating that list, or if it has been automated at this point. Lauren left the team a few months ago. Last I heard it's about a once weekly process to get items into the Made for HoloLens section. As far as I know, it's not ranked or anything like that, it's just a matter of someone at Microsoft aggregating all the HoloLens apps and updating that set.
